Proof that Jesus Died On CROSS Just Before the Passover Feast in 33 AD

 

This one seems obvious to many people, but it can quickly

become confusing due to a number of factors: how the scriptures

were translated, how and when the Jewish feasts occur, who

was alive and ruling at the time, and some indication from a

prior prophecy and the history behind that prophecy.

 

That last one was already covered in a previous article concerning

Daniel 9, where Jesus was predicted to die in 33 AD. So here is a

starting point to reference from, was the prediction correct, or not?

 

History records 3 prominent rulers mentioned in the New

Testament at the time that Jesus was said to have died:

 

* Tiberious Caesar ruled from 14 AD - 37 AD

 

* Herod Antipas ruled from 4 BC - 39 AD, he divorced his wife

and married his half brother Herod's wife, which caused

John the Baptist to condemn that marriage, and John then

lost his head for saying such.

 

* Pontius Pilate ruled from 26 AD - 36 AD.

 

Pilate's rule looks to limit Jesus's year of death to a

span of only 10 years time. The gospel of Luke says that

John the Baptist started preaching in the 15th year of

Tiberius Caesar's rule: 14 AD + 15 - 1 = 28 AD

 

Given John the Baptist's arrival, needing to preach for a while

first (let's guess a year for John to preach), and that Jesus

had to later minister for more than 3 years, Jesus had to have

died some time after: 28 + 1 + 3 = 32 AD, and also had to die

before Pilate left his position in 36 AD. Therefore, Jesus died

some time between 32 AD and 36 AD.

 

The 33 AD prediction falls within the 32 AD to 36 AD time span.

 

What about the Jewish feasts, do they help confirm the year?

To answer this, you have to know more about the Passover and

which day Jesus would have died on.

 

The bible records which day Jesus died on:

 

John 19:31 The Jews therefore, because it was the preparation,

that the bodies should not remain upon the cross on

the Sabbath day, (for that Sabbath day was an high

day,) besought Pilate that their legs might be broken,

and that they might be taken away.

 

So clearly, Jesus died just prior to the Sabbath, and it was

also a Sabbath that was a "high day" of the Passover feast week.

 

What is a "high day"?

 

The high days in the Passover feast week, are the first and last

days of the 7 Passover feast days of eating unleavened bread. The

first high day could start any day of the week, due to the fact

that the month of Nissan would start on the day that two witnesses

would see the new moon show up, and that day of the week varied

each year. They would kill the Passover lamb on the 14th day of

Nissan, and the unleavened bread would be eaten from the 15th

on for 7 days. The 2nd high day, was the 7th day or last day of the

7 day Passover feast. For that Passover the year Jesus died, the

first high day was said by John to have been the same day as the

Sabbath.

 

In simple terms showing what occurred per day (while noting that days

back then ran from evening to evening, and that the Sabbath starts

on Friday evening), this is how it looked to John back then describing

which day it was in the verse above:

 

"day" What was occurring that day

-

|

Thursday evening to | Nissan 14, Day of Preparation, Jesus dies

Friday evening | during the daylight hours on Friday.

|

-

| Nissan 15, Sabbath, the first day of the 7

Friday evening to | day Passover feast week begins, it's also

Saturday evening | called the 1st "high day" of the Passover

| feast week. Jesus's body is in the tomb.

-

 

etc...

 

(the 7 days of the passover feast continue on, with the last day of

the passover feast week being the 2nd "high day")

 

It is possible to find all years where the first high day fell on

the Sabbath to verify which years are possible candidates for the

year of Jesus's death. As it turns out, between the years 27AD

and 38AD, there are only 2 years where the high day fell on a Sabbath

and those two years are 33AD and 36AD. So given this, during the

period of 32AD to 36AD (after John started preaching plus Jesus's

preaching, yet before Pilate's rule ended), the only years possible

for Jesus to have died in, are 33 AD and 36 AD.

 

The 36 AD year is ruled out for a number of reasons. Essentially

too many things had to happen during that year, and one account

given, becomes void when 36 AD is checked as a possible crucifixtion

date. Pilate was told to return to Rome in 36 AD, he arrived there

after Tiberius Caesar died, before Passover in 37AD. Herod Antipas

was in a war with Aretus in 36AD and wouldn't have had time to be

across the Dead Sea during the preparation of Passover at Jesus's

trial. Herod Antipas was said to have been desiring to see Jesus,

but in 36 AD, that was during a time of Herod's war and preparing

for war with Aretus. There is also the issue that if Jesus died

in 36 AD, with a 3.5 year ministry that makes him 32.5 (or older)

at the start of it, and Luke said he "began to be about 30" (29.5?)

at that time. His birth as the next article states, had to happen

soon after the tetrarchy was formed so the people could be

registered under their specific tetrarch, and that happened only

2 or 3 years after 4 BC, making Jesus too old for Luke's statement

that Jesus "began to be about 30". The 33 AD crucifiction year,

does not have any of the issues the 36AD year has.

 

The only year that matches all accounts, is 33 AD.
